What is Referral Marketing?
Referral marketing entails encouraging your existing customers to refer new clients to your business. This can happen through incentivized programs, where customers receive rewards for successful referrals, or organically, simply by sharing positive experiences.
Why Adopt Referral Marketing in Durban?
Durban has a vibrant and diverse population, making it an ideal location for referral marketing. Benefits include:
- Trustworthy Recommendations: People tend to trust personal recommendations more than traditional advertising, leading to higher conversion rates.
- Cost-Effective: Compared to other marketing channels, referral programs often cost less due to their reliance on existing customers.
- Enhanced Customer Loyalty: By incentivizing referrals, you foster a sense of loyalty among your clients, making them feel valued.
How to Create a Successful Referral Marketing Program
Follow these essential steps to build an impactful referral marketing program:
1. Identify Your Goals
Clearly outline what you want to achieve. Whether it’s increasing customer acquisition, boosting sales, or enhancing brand awareness, knowing your targets will guide your program’s structure.
2. Define Your Incentives
Choose incentives that resonate with your customer base. This could be discounts, free products, or exclusive access to services. Make sure they’re appealing enough to motivate referrals.
3. Simplify the Referral Process
Make it easy for customers to refer others. Use referral links, social sharing options, or easy-to-complete forms. The more straightforward the process, the more likely it is that your customers will participate.
4. Promote Your Program
Utilize email marketing, social media, and your website to promote your referral program. Make sure the benefits are clear and visible.
5. Monitor and Optimize
Regularly track the performance of your referral program. Look at the conversion rates, customer feedback, and overall satisfaction to refine and improve your strategy.
